MemberI’m interested in creating custom audibles. Anyone know if that can be done, and how?
July 22, 2004 at 5:30 am #79252UnSaKreD
MemberAudibles are shockwave files, that are stored on yahoo’s servers.
You can make them all you want, but you wont be able to send them.
each one has their own code, like base.us.taunts.whatever
